Abstract
A gas nozzle (), a gas reaction device () and a gas hydrolysis reaction method. A plurality of fuel gas channels () are provided on a side wall of a nozzle cavity () of the gas nozzle (); the plurality of fuel gas channels () are arranged around the side wall of the nozzle cavity (); a mixed gas introduced from a nozzle inlet () is surrounded by a fuel gas () introduced from the plurality of fuel gas channels (); and the fuel gas channels () are inclined towards a nozzle outlet (), and the fuel gas channels () are further inclined in the same clockwise direction. In this way, the fuel gas () introduced from the plurality of fuel gas channels () forms a downwardly conical spiral flame, and a flame formed by the mixed gas introduced from the nozzle inlet () is wrapped therein and sprayed out from the nozzle outlet ().
